Stripped and Refinished Stock Formula Rims/Wheels. What do ya'll think?

So this is the stock rim with the outer lip restored. (Sorry forgot to take one before.).



Pic of car before paint---


This is after I stripped them and repainted them...




So the process was as follows:

1. I masked off the inner lip where the rim meets the lip.

2. Used Aircraft Stripper and applied heavily all the way around the rim. (BTW Use Gloves. It is similar to acid. The burning through the fingers part. Learned that the hard way.

3. Used super fine steel wool (0000) to remove stock clearcoat.

3.a. Repeated Step 2 if needed.

4. USE A TOOTHBRUSH to get in the small areas.

5. Wipe off with a paper towel. Or many.

6. Spray down with water.

7. And i Used EAGLE One Never Dull which works wonders on any dull or faded metal.

Paint Stage...

1. Mask off finished lip.

2. Paint it.*

*It is a helluva lot easier to paint in the holes in you stand the wheel up and paint through the back.

Color is Metallic Black. But you cant see the metallic in the pics.
